Empowering Women's Health through Digital Innovation
higroup's collaboration with Medis resulted in Mydonna, a platform focused on women's health. Offering products for period discomfort, pregnancy, fertility, and wellness, it includes a blog and quizzes for personalized recommendations.
Tools
- Laravel
- JavaScript
- CSS
- HTML/HTML5
- Vue.js
- AWS
- MySQL
- HyGraph
- DotDigital
- BigCommerce
- Stripe
Live Preview

CHALLENGE
Creating MyDonna meant more than building an e-commerce site—it was about empowering women through a platform that educates, blends wellness, and shopping in a traditionally stigmatized space. We faced the challenge of designing a seamless user experience that respects privacy, ensures trust in health-related purchases, and offers tailored guidance. The goal: normalize conversations around women menstrual and intimate care.


Confident Intimacy Starts with Choice
MyDonna is your personal destination for intimate care, offering a curated selection of products tailored to every stage of womanhood—from pregnancy to everyday wellness. We believe that education and empowerment go hand in hand, which is why the platform not only provides trusted products but also supports women with expert guidance on intimacy, hygiene, and self-care. Feel confident in your body with solutions designed for your health, comfort, and confidence.
1
Women’s Health E‑Commerce
2
Health Tech Innovation
3
Data Privacy Compliance


35%
Conversion rate increased by 35%.
180%
User base grew by over 180% in the first year!
90%
Customer satisfaction is exceptionally high at around 90%.


SOLUTION
We strategically integrated Hygraph, BigCommerce, Stripe, and DotDigital to build a secure and scalable platform tailored to women’s health. Beyond tech, we addressed the business challenge of normalizing conversations around intimate care by creating a personalized, educational, and stigma-free shopping experience. The platform guides users to informed decisions, fosters trust in sensitive product categories, and positions MyDonna as a go-to wellness destination.


Seamless Digital Solution
From back-in-stock notifications and loyalty-based account benefits to intuitive mobile registration and product subscription flows, the platform focuses on personalization and convenience. Users can explore educational content around period care, filter articles by topics, and enjoy a tailored shopping experience. Each touchpoint reflects MyDonna’s mission: to provide stigma-free, accessible, and user-friendly digital health services for women, supported by clean UX and thoughtful content integration.
001
Project Discovery
002
Website Development
003
Quality Assurance and Optimization
004
DevOps Setup
005
Website Launch
006
Support

ENDING REMARKS
MyDonna redefined what a women’s health platform can be—personalized, educational, and stigma-free. By blending thoughtful UX with robust technology, we helped Medis deliver a secure, empowering experience that supports women in every stage of life. From concept to market success, this project showcases the power of collaboration, innovation, and a mission-driven approach to digital wellness.


Do you have a specific idea in mind?
Share your vision, and we'll explore how we can make it happen together.
Related work
See this service in practice

const set ActiveItem = (value: string) => { activeItem.value = value;}onMounted(() => { console.log(`Component mounted! Active item: ${activeItem.title}`)})const const activeItem = ref('Home')const set ActiveItem = (value: string) => { activeItem.value = value;}onMounted(() => { console.log(`Component mounted! Active item: ${activeItem.title}`)})const const activeItem = ref('Home')
const set ActiveItem = (value: string) => { activeItem.value = value;}onMounted(() => { console.log(`Component mounted! Active item: ${activeItem.title}`)})const const activeItem = ref('Home')const set ActiveItem = (value: string) => { activeItem.value = value;}onMounted(() =>
Design & Discovery, Product Engineering, Cloud & DevOps
Custom sales platform for selling exclusive jewlery

const set ActiveItem = (value: string) => { activeItem.value = value;}onMounted(() => { console.log(`Component mounted! Active item: ${activeItem.title}`)})const const activeItem = ref('Home')const set ActiveItem = (value: string) => { activeItem.value = value;}onMounted(() => { console.log(`Component mounted! Active item: ${activeItem.title}`)})const const activeItem = ref('Home')
const set ActiveItem = (value: string) => { activeItem.value = value;}onMounted(() => { console.log(`Component mounted! Active item: ${activeItem.title}`)})const const activeItem = ref('Home')const set ActiveItem = (value: string) => { activeItem.value = value;}onMounted(() =>
Design & Discovery, Product Engineering
Platform for Empowering Social Sustainability

const set ActiveItem = (value: string) => { activeItem.value = value;}onMounted(() => { console.log(`Component mounted! Active item: ${activeItem.title}`)})const const activeItem = ref('Home')const set ActiveItem = (value: string) => { activeItem.value = value;}onMounted(() => { console.log(`Component mounted! Active item: ${activeItem.title}`)})const const activeItem = ref('Home')
const set ActiveItem = (value: string) => { activeItem.value = value;}onMounted(() => { console.log(`Component mounted! Active item: ${activeItem.title}`)})const const activeItem = ref('Home')const set ActiveItem = (value: string) => { activeItem.value = value;}onMounted(() =>
Product Engineering, Cloud & DevOps, Design & Discovery
Digitalizing Factory Assembly Line